Many other species, besides the five now described, produce cleistogamic
flowers; this is the case, according to D. Muller, Michalet, Von Mohl, and
Hermann Muller, with V. elatior, lancifolia, sylvatica, palustris, mirabilis,
bicolor, ionodium, and biflora. But V. tricolor does not produce them.
Michalet asserts that V. palustris produces near Paris only perfect flowers,
which are quite fertile; but that when the plant grows on mountains cleistogamic
flowers are produced; and so it is with V. biflora. The same author states that
he has seen in the case of V. alba flowers intermediate in structure between the
perfect and cleistogamic ones. According to M. Boisduval, an Italian species, V.
Ruppii, never bears in France “des fleurs bien apparentes, ce qui ne l’empeche
pas de fructifier.”
It is interesting to observe the gradation in the abortion of the parts in the
cleistogamic flowers of the several foregoing species. It appears from the
statements by D. Muller and Von Mohl that in V. mirabilis the calyx does not
remain quite closed; all five stamens are provided with anthers, and some
pollen-grains probably fall out of the cells on the stigma, instead of
protruding their tubes whilst still enclosed, as in the other species. In V.
hirta all five stamens are likewise antheriferous; the petals are not so much
reduced and the pistil not so much modified as in the following species. In V.
nana and elatior only two of the stamens properly bear anthers, but sometimes
one or even two of the others are thus provided. Lastly, in V. canina never more
than two of the stamens, as far as I have seen, bear anthers; the petals are
much more reduced than in V. hirta, and according to D. Muller are sometimes
quite absent.
